Output 2c0314fef207c81bd6f0b46925ff9fceb1ff2f31d0f42b2a93d6139db69659bc:0

value
75987087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9acd689955d94984c69d89842096c7f1209153d9 OP_EQUAL
address
3FoY48BbnQyK5omNp8iP19yav77M3DTDmP
transaction
2c0314fef207c81bd6f0b46925ff9fceb1ff2f31d0f42b2a93d6139db69659bc
spent
true